2. GENERAL DESCRIPTION
The CS4202 is a mixed-signal serial audio codec
with integrated headphone power amplifier com-
pliant with the Intel
Audio Codec ’97 Specifica-
tion
, revision 2.2 [6] (referred to as AC ’97). It is
designed to be paired with a digital controller, typ-
ically located on the PCI bus or integrated within
the system core logic chip set. The controller is re-
sponsible for all communications between the
CS4202 and the remainder of the system. The
CS4202 contains two distinct functional sections:
digital and analog. The digital section includes the
AC-link interface, S/PDIF interface, serial data
port, GPIO, power management support, and Sam-
pleRate Converters (SRCs). The analog section in-
cludes the analog input multiplexer (mux), stereo
input mixer, stereo output mixer, mono output mix-
er, headphone amplifier, stereo Analog-to-Digital
Converters (ADCs), stereo Digital-to-Analog Con-
verters (DACs), and their associated volume con-
trols.
2.1
AC-Link
All communication with the CS4202 is established
with a 5-wire digital interface to the controller
called the AC-link. This interface is shown in
Figure 7.All clocking for theserial communication
is synchronous to the BIT_CLK signal. BIT_CLK
isgenerated by the primary audio codecand isused
to clock the controller and any secondary audio co-
decs. Both input and output AC-link audio frames
are organized as a sequence of 256 serial bits form-
ing 13 groups referred to as‘slots’. During each au-
dio frame, data is passed bi-directionally between
the CS4202 and the controller. The input frame is
driven from the CS4202 on the SDATA_IN line.
The output frame is driven from the controller on
the SDATA_OUT line. The controller is also re-
sponsible for issuing reset commands via the RE-
SET# signal. Following a Cold Reset, the CS4202
is responsible for notifying the controller that it is
ready for operation after synchronizing its internal
functions. The CS4202 AC-link signals must use
thesame digital supply voltage asthecontroller,ei-
ther +5 Vor +3.3 V. SeeSection 3,
AC-Link Frame
Definition
, for detailed AC-link information.
